Three high-stakes federal byelections in Quebec, Ontario, and British Columbia could reveal whether the Liberals can hold onto their slim majority—or if the opposition is gaining momentum ahead of bigger elections. With trade tensions with the U.S. dominating headlines, voters are weighing big-picture politics as they head to the polls. The seats opened for varied reasons: one due to an MP becoming ambassador to the EU, another from a resignation, and the third when an MP joined the Senate. These votes aren’t just about filling vacancies—they’re a critical barometer of public sentiment and a preview of what’s to come.
